My Buying Guides on Privacy Frosted Window Film

What I Look for First

When I shop for privacy frosted window film, I start by thinking about where I’ll use it. For me, the main goal is usually privacy, but I also want to keep natural light coming in. I check whether the film is suitable for bathrooms, bedrooms, offices, or front doors, since each space has different needs.

Types of Frosted Window Film I Consider

I usually see a few main options:

  • Static cling film: Easy for me to apply and remove without adhesive.
  • Adhesive-backed film: Better if I want a more permanent solution.
  • Decorative frosted film: Good when I want privacy with a stylish pattern.
  • One-way privacy film: Useful in certain lighting conditions, though I still check how it performs at night.

Privacy Level

Privacy is the biggest reason I buy frosted film, so I always check how much visibility it blocks. Some films only blur shapes, while others completely obscure the view. I choose based on how much privacy I need during the day and at night.

Light Transmission

I like frosted film that gives me privacy without making the room dark. Some films let in plenty of daylight, which helps keep my space bright and comfortable. If I’m using it in a room that already feels dim, I make sure the film won’t block too much light.

Ease of Installation

I prefer a film that is simple to install, especially if I’m doing it myself. I look for products that come with clear instructions, a smoothing tool, or grid lines for cutting. If I want a temporary option, static cling is usually easier for me than adhesive film.

Durability and Quality

I pay attention to how thick and durable the film feels. A good-quality film should resist peeling, bubbling, and fading over time. If I’m placing it in a humid area like a bathroom, I make sure it is moisture-resistant.

Size and Customization

Before I buy, I measure my windows carefully. I like films that come in different widths and lengths so I can cut them to fit. If the window has an unusual shape, I look for a product that is easy for me to trim neatly.

Removability

I always think about whether I may want to change the look later. If I rent my home or like to update my décor often, I usually choose a removable film. Static cling works well for me because it can be taken off without leaving much residue.

Style and Design

Even though privacy is the main purpose, I still care about appearance. Some frosted films are plain, while others have patterns, borders, or etched-glass effects. I choose a style that matches the room and adds a clean, finished look.

My Final Buying Tip

When I buy privacy frosted window film, I balance privacy, light, installation ease, and durability. For me, the best product is the one that fits my window, looks good in my space, and gives me the level of privacy I need without making the room feel closed off.
